Market Ecosystem and Operational Framework

Key Product Categories:

The market primarily comprises:

  • On-Premises Auto Attendant Systems:

    Traditional hardware-centric solutions suited for large enterprises with dedicated IT infrastructure.

  • Cloud-Based Auto Attendant Solutions:

    SaaS models offering scalability, remote management, and lower upfront costs, increasingly favored by SMEs and agile organizations.

  • Hybrid Systems:

    Combining on-premises and cloud features for tailored deployment.

Cost Structures, Pricing Strategies, and Investment Patterns

Cost structures vary significantly between on-premises and cloud solutions. On-premises systems entail higher capital expenditure (CapEx) for hardware and licensing, whereas cloud solutions favor operational expenditure (OpEx) with subscription-based pricing. The average initial investment for a mid-sized enterprise auto attendant system ranges from €15,000 to €50,000, with annual maintenance and upgrade costs constituting 10-15% of initial CapEx.

Pricing strategies are increasingly shifting toward value-based models, emphasizing ROI through improved customer satisfaction and operational efficiency. Enterprises are willing to pay premiums for AI-enabled features, scalability, and integration capabilities.

Risk Factors & Regulatory Challenges

Key risks include:

  • Regulatory Compliance:

    Data privacy laws such as GDPR impose strict requirements on data handling, storage, and processing, necessitating compliance investments.

  • Cybersecurity Threats:

    As auto attendant systems become more connected and cloud-based, they are vulnerable to cyberattacks, requiring robust security protocols.

  • Technological Obsolescence:

    Rapid innovation cycles demand continuous upgrades; failure to adapt may lead to market attrition.

  • Market Fragmentation:

    Diverse vendor landscapes and regional regulatory differences complicate standardization and interoperability efforts.

Adoption Trends & Use Cases by End-User Segments

Banking & Financial Services:

Deployment of AI-powered auto attendants for customer onboarding, transaction inquiries, and fraud detection. Example: Major French banks integrating speech recognition for 24/7 customer support.

Healthcare:

Automating appointment scheduling, patient inquiries, and emergency response systems, especially in hospital networks.

Retail & E-commerce:

Enhancing call routing during peak seasons, integrating with CRM for personalized service, and supporting omnichannel customer engagement.

Government & Public Sector:

Streamlining citizen inquiries, service requests, and emergency notifications through scalable auto attendant platforms.

Shifting consumption patterns favor cloud solutions, with SMEs increasingly adopting SaaS models due to lower upfront costs and faster deployment cycles.
